Claim Missing Document
Check
Articles

Exploring Success Factor for Mobile based Smart Regency Service using TRUTAUT Model Approach Aang Kisnu Darmawan; Daniel Siahaan; Tony Dwi Susanto; Hoiriyah Hoiriyah; Busro Umam; Anwari Anwari
Proceeding of the Electrical Engineering Computer Science and Informatics Vol 7, No 1: EECSI 2020
Publisher : IAES Indonesia Section

Show Abstract | Download Original | Original Source | Check in Google Scholar | DOI: 10.11591/eecsi.v7.2074

Abstract

Currently, almost every country struggles to apply city management to the concept of intelligent cities. Several previous studies have modeled the success, maturity, and success of information systems to use smart city principles. However, there are significant differences between city and district definition in terms of governance frameworks, regional size, livelihood differences, population, socio-economic, and socio-cultural dimensions. Therefore, work on the Smart District IT assessment requires new and unique studies that can differ substantially from smart cities. This study aims to explore the determinants of the success of Smart Regency services with mobile technology. The model and approach are the TRUTAUT model, which combines the concepts for the TRI and the UTAUT model. Two hundred eighty-nine participants could collect data with a smart cellular district service system - data processing using the SmartPLS v.3.2.8 software. Recent findings indicate that the variables proposed in the TRUTAUT model are a positive and essential relation. This study helps to determine the success of the application of intelligent mobile regional services applications. This study confirms that policymakers pay more considerable attention to critical questions that affect the district's smart cellular services' success.
Software Fault Prediction Using Filtering Feature Selection in Cluster-Based Classification Fachrul Pralienka Bani Muhamad; Daniel Oranova Siahaan; Chastine Fatichah
IPTEK Journal of Proceedings Series No 1 (2018): 3rd International Seminar on Science and Technology (ISST) 2017
Publisher : Institut Teknologi Sepuluh Nopember

Show Abstract | Download Original | Original Source | Check in Google Scholar | Full PDF (203.209 KB) | DOI: 10.12962/j23546026.y2018i1.3508

Abstract

The high accuracy of software fault prediction can help testing effort and improving software quality. Previous researchers had proposed the combination of Entropy-Based Discretization (EBD) and Cluster-Based Classification (CBC). However, the irrelevant and redundant features in software fault dataset tend to decrease the prediction accuracy value. This study proposes improvement of CBC outcomes by integrating filtering feature selection methods. Filtering feature selection methods that will be integrated with CBC i.e. Information Gain (IG), Gain Ratio (GR), and One-R (OR). Based on the research using 2 datasets NASA public MDP (i.e. PC2 and PC3), the result shows that the combination of CBC and IG yields the best average accuracy value compared to GR and OR. It generates 67.52% average of probability detection (pd) and 37.42% average of probability false alarm (pf). While CBC without feature selection yields 65.38% average pd and 49.95% average pf. It can be concluded that IG can improve CBC outcomes by increasing 2.14% average pd and reducing 12.53% average pf
User Story Extraction from Online News with FeatureBased and Maximum Entropy Method for Software Requirements Elicitation Nafingatun Ngaliah; Daniel Siahaan; Indra Kharisma Raharjana
IPTEK The Journal for Technology and Science Vol 32, No 3 (2021)
Publisher : IPTEK, LPPM, Institut Teknologi Sepuluh Nopember

Show Abstract | Download Original | Original Source | Check in Google Scholar | DOI: 10.12962/j20882033.v32i3.11625

Abstract

Software requirements query is the frst stage in software requirements engineering. Elicitation is the process of identifying software requirements from various sources such as interviews with resource persons, questionnaires, document analysis, etc. The user story is easy to adapt according to changing system requirements. The user story is a semi-structured language because the compilation of user stories must follow the syntax as a standard for writing features in agile software development methods. In addition, user story also easily understood by end-users who do not have an information technology background because they contain descriptions of system requirements in natural language. In making user stories, there are three aspects, namely the who aspect (actor), what aspect (activity), and the why aspect (reason). This study proposes the extraction of user stories consisting of who and what aspects of online news sites using feature extraction and maximum entropy as a classifcation method. The systems analyst can use the actual information related to the lessons obtained in the online news to get the required software requirements. The expected result of the extraction method in this research is to produce user stories relevant to the software requirements to assist systems analysts in generating requirements. This proposed method shows that the average precision and recall are 98.21% and 95.16% for the who aspect; 87,14% and 87,50% for what aspects; 81.21% and 78.60% for user stories. Thus, this result suggests that the proposed method generates user stories relevant to functional software.
Weighted k Nearest Neighbor Using Grey Relational Analysis To Solve Missing Value Desepta Isna Ulumi; Daniel Siahaan
IPTEK The Journal for Technology and Science Vol 29, No 3 (2018)
Publisher : IPTEK, LPPM, Institut Teknologi Sepuluh Nopember

Show Abstract | Download Original | Original Source | Check in Google Scholar | Full PDF (497.699 KB) | DOI: 10.12962/j20882033.v29i3.5011

Abstract

Software defect prediction model is an important role in detecting the most vulnerable component error software. Some research have been worked to improve the accuracy of the prediction defects of the software in order to manage human, costs and time. But previous research used specific dataset for software defect prediction model. However, there is no a generic dataset handling for software defect prediction model yet. This research proposed improvements to the results of the software defect prediction on the merged dataset, which is called generic dataset, with a number of different features. In order to balance the number of features, each dataset should be filled with a missing value. To fill the missing values, Weighted k Nearest Neighbor (WkNN) method was used. Then, after missing values were filled, Naïve Bayes was used to classify the selected features. This research needed to obtain a set of features which was relevant, then performed a feature selection method. The results showed that by using seven NASA public MDP datasets, Naïve Bayes with Information Gain (IG) or Symmetric Uncertainty (SU) feature selection presented the best balance value.Software defect, NASA public MDP, weighted KNN,Naive Bayes
Web-Based Tsunami Early Warning System Daniel Siahaan; Royke Wenas; Amien Widodo; Umi Yuhana
IPTEK The Journal for Technology and Science Vol 24, No 3 (2013)
Publisher : IPTEK, LPPM, Institut Teknologi Sepuluh Nopember

Show Abstract | Download Original | Original Source | Check in Google Scholar | DOI: 10.12962/j20882033.v24i3.552

Abstract

Tsunami is a serious threat to the island nation such as Indonesia. The tsunami disasters that were occurred in some parts of Indonesia have immerged the need for tsunami early warning system that is reliable and can be applied to the Indonesian archipelago. North Sulawesi is one of the areas prone to tsunamis since this area lies in the path called the ring of fire's. This article describes a tsunami simulation application for the north coast of North Sulawesi. Web-based applications were built so that they can be monitored online from anywhere and at anytime. This system reads the real-time seismic data that affect the North Sulawesi region from a number of sources. Dynamic and static data that are received are processed using data mining method to predict the chances of a tsunami, while flood flooding algorithm is used to visualize the map of affected areas of North Sulawesi. The resulting information is available in detail in the form of web pages and also through short message to the relevant authorities handling of the tsunami disaster in order for them to act in accordance with applicable standard operating procedures. With this application, the public can obtain information that is more accurate. Relevant authorities can conduct tsunami disaster mitigation measures more effectively.
Algorithms Comparison for Non-Requirements Classification using the Semantic Feature of Software Requirement Statements Achmad An'im Fahmi; Daniel Siahaan
IPTEK The Journal for Technology and Science Vol 31, No 3 (2020)
Publisher : IPTEK, LPPM, Institut Teknologi Sepuluh Nopember

Show Abstract | Download Original | Original Source | Check in Google Scholar | DOI: 10.12962/j20882033.v31i3.7606

Abstract

Noise in a Software Requirements Specification (SRS) is an irrelevant requirements statement or a non-requirements statement. This can be confusing to the reader and can have negative repercussions in later stages of software development. This study proposes a classification model to detect the second type of noise, the non-requirements statement. The classification model that is built is based on the semantic features of the non-requirements statement. This research also compares the five best-supervised machine learning methods to date, which are support vector machine (SVM), naïve Bayes (NB), random forest (RF), k-nearest neighbor (kNN), and Decision Tree. This comparison aimed to determine which method can produce the best non-requirements classification, model. The comparison shows that the best model is produced by the SVM method with an average accuracy of 0.96. The most significant features in this non-requirement classification model are the requirements statement or non-requirements, id statement, normalized mean value, standard deviation value, similarity variant value, standard deviation normalization value, maximum normalized value, similarity variant normalization value, value Bad NN, mean value, number of sentences, bad VB score, and project id.
Metrik Ergonomi Untuk Produk Perangkat Lunak Permainan Pada Aspek Kenyamanan Arif Susanto; Daniel Oranova Siahaan
Melek IT : Information Technology Journal Vol. 1 No. 1 (2015): Melek IT : Information Technology Journal
Publisher : Informatics Engineering Department-UWKS

Show Abstract | Download Original | Original Source | Check in Google Scholar | Full PDF (244.866 KB) | DOI: 10.30742/melekitjournal.v1i1.35

Abstract

It is inevitable that humans have a limited ability to interact with a product or technology that is made. Limitations on the human body is the reason the importance of ergonomic aspects need to be implemented in the design of a product. In the field of information technology, research-related metric ergonomics of a product has been focused on hardware products, such as mouse, monitor and keyboard. This study builds a metric measurement of ergonomic comfort aspect to the game software products. This study primarily consists of several steps. First, an analysis of ergonomic aspects in comfort. Second, these aspects are mapped into the attributes that exist in software quality models like McCall, Boehm and ISO 9126/25010. Third, the preparation of ergonomics metrics based on an analysis of the test results in previous stages. Attributes that are considered relevant as a reference for the testing of the game software. Game software predetermined expert / expert tested the user directly to the start of the installation process until the stage play of the game software. From the analysis of the proposed ergonomics testing metrics, generated 11 software attributes offline games based desktop that can characterize whether a software-based desktop offline games comfortable or not.
Perbaikan Model Kebergunaan Pada Aplikasi Perangkat Bergerak Dengan Menambahkan Atribut Gejala Buruk Cahya Bagus Sanjaya; Daniel Siahaan
Melek IT : Information Technology Journal Vol. 1 No. 2 (2015): Melek IT : Information Technology Journal
Publisher : Informatics Engineering Department-UWKS

Show Abstract | Download Original | Original Source | Check in Google Scholar | Full PDF (617.027 KB) | DOI: 10.30742/melekitjournal.v1i2.47

Abstract

Usability is a very important aspect and one of the key factors for the successful mobile application. Usability is an attribute to define the quality of user interface and the quality of interaction between user and application. Models to measure the usability of desktop application can not directly be used for mobile applications because of the differences between the characteristics of desktop applications and mobile applications. Previous research developed a model to measure usability on a mobile application. Somehow, it lacks recommendations for new user interface usability evaluation of the mobile application that is being measured and there is no weighting for each attribute. This study combines qualitative primary data taken from questionnaires and quantitative secondary data taken from the activity logs application (Bad Symptoms) when user run mobile application. Weighting for each attribute is done by an expert of mobile applications. Analytical Hierarchy Process (AHP) Method is used to analyze experimental data. Result from this research is a novel model to measure usability for mobile application that have a weight to each usability attributes and provides recommendation for improvement of existing user interfaces.
Peningkatan Kompetensi Guru-Guru Playgroup Dan TK Sepuluh Nopember Surabaya Melalui Pelatihan TIK Ahmad Saikhu; Daniel Oranova Siahaan; FX Arunanto; Rully Soelaiman; Fajar Baskoro
Sewagati Vol 5 No 1 (2021)
Publisher : Pusat Publikasi ITS

Show Abstract | Download Original | Original Source | Check in Google Scholar | Full PDF (874.427 KB)

Abstract

Keberadaan Playgroup dan Taman Kanak-kanak Sepuluh Nopember merupakan bagian dari sejarah panjang eksistensi perumahan dosen dan karyawan ITS. Awalnya lembaga ini didirikan atas inisiatif Dharma Wanita Unit ITS untuk mengakomodasi kebutuhan sekolah taman kanak-kanak bagi dosen dan karyawan ITS yang berdomisili di perumahan dinas ITS Keputih Sukolilo Surabaya. Sehingga lembaga ini pun dinamakan Taman Kanak-kanak Dharma Wanita ITS. Namun seiring dengan perkembangan wilayah Kecamatan Sukolilo, khususnya di Kelurahan Keputih yang begitu pesat dengan munculnya banyak pemukiman baru, maka siswa taman kanak-kanak inipun berkembang dengan menerima siswa-siswa dari luar perumahan dinas ITS. Dengan munculnya kebutuhan belajar bagi anak-anak balita, maka lembaga ini berkembang dengan membuka kelas playgroup. Untuk pengembangan kurikulum pengajarannya, selain berdasarkan ketentuan dan panduan yang dikeluarkan oleh Dinas Pendidikan Provinsi Jawa Timur, lembaga ini dapat menambahkan konten-konten pengajaran yang sesuai dengan karakteristik lembaga ini sendiri. Dalam kesempatan melaksanakan kegiatan pengabdian kepada masyarakat kali ini diajarkan kepada guru-guru playgroup dan Taman Kanak-kanak Sepuluh Nopember tentang merancang pembelajaran dengan memanfaatkan programmable robot untuk anak-anak. Kegiatan pembelajaran dengan menggunakan robot ini akan menarik minat anak-anak untuk secara tidak langsung mengenal dasar-dasar pemikiran yang terstruktur. Sementara dalam pelaksanaannya juga tidak tidak memerlukan investasi yang besar. Hanya cukup dengan seperangkat programmable robot beserta buku panduan untuk memprogramnya menggunakan Scratch.
KLASIFIKASI KEBUTUHAN PERANGKAT LUNAK BERDASARKAN KATEGORI ISO/IEC 25000 MENGGUNAKAN TEXTRANK DAN SVM Mutia Rahmi Dewi; Fatimatus Zulfa; Dady Khairul Imam; Daniel Oranova Siahaan
Jurnal Sistem Informasi Bisnis (JUNSIBI) Vol 4 No 2 (2023): Jurnal Sistem Informasi Bisnis (JUNSIBI)
Publisher : Program Studi Sistem Informasi Institut Bisnis dan Informatika (IBI) Kosgoro 1957

Show Abstract | Download Original | Original Source | Check in Google Scholar | DOI: 10.55122/junsibi.v4i2.736

Abstract

Perancangan kebutuhan perangkat lunak merupakan langkah pertama yang harus dilakukan dalam perencanaan membangun perangkat lunak. Untuk mempermudah melakukan analisis, kebutuhan perangkat lunak dapat dikategorikan ke dalam standar kualitas. Salah satu standar kualitas dapat menggunakan ISO/IEC 25000. Seri ISO/IEC 25000 terdiri dari 8 karakteristik yaitu Functional Suitability, Performance Efficiency, Compatibility, Usability, Reliability, Security, Maintainability, dan Portability. Untuk mempermudah dan mempercepat analisis diperlukan klasifikasi secara otomatis. Berbagai metode klasifikasi terhadap standar kualitas kebutuhan perangkat lunak telah diusulkan. Pada penelitian ini, melakukan ekstraksi kata kunci dari kebutuhan perangkat lunak menggunakan metode TextRank untuk melakukan klasifikasi terhadap standar kualitas ISO/IEC 25000. Kata kunci yang telah diekstraksi mewakili istilah pada kebutuhan perangkat lunak. Sebanyak 154 kebutuhan dari 5 perangkat lunak diekstraksi menjadi 66 kata kunci yang akan digunakan untuk melakukan klasifikasi terhadap standar kualitas ISO/IEC 25000. Pada penelitian ini, didapatkan hasil presisi sebesar 83% dan recall sebesar 80.3% dengan menggunakan klasifikasi Support Vector Machine (SVM).
Co-Authors Aang Kisnu Darmawan Abd. Rasyid Syamsuri Achmad An'im Fahmi Achmad, Fariz Adi Kurniawan Aditya Eka Bagaskara Ahmad Saikhu Ahmadiyah, Adhatus Solichah Ainatul Maulida Akbar, Rizky Januar Albert Bungaran Manik Amalia, Rosa Amien Widodo Andi Besse Firdausiah Andini Prastiwi Andrias Meisyal Yuwantoko Anggraini, Ratih Nur Esti Ansyah, Adi Surya Suwardi Anwari Anwari Anwari, Anwari Arif Djunaidy Arif Susanto Arif Wibisono Ary Mazharuddin Shiddiqi Asyrofi, Raka Baskoro, Fajar Bawamenewi, Yuliaman Busro Umam Cahya Bagus Sanjaya Chastine Fatichah Dady Khairul Imam Damanik, Juli Yanti Darnoto, Brian Depandi Enda Desepta Isna Ulumi Divi Galih Prasetyo Putri Dzhalila, Dzhillan Eko Prasetyo Evi Triandini F.X. Arunanto Fachrul Pralienka Bani Muhamad Fachrul Pralienka Bani Muhamad Fajar Baskoro Fajar Baskoro Fatimatus Zulfa Ferdika Bagus Permana Forca, Adrian FX Arunanto Ghipari, Maulana Halawa, Enggi Hamidi, Mohammad Zaenuddin Hoiriyah Hoiriyah Hoiriyah, Hoiriyah I Gede Suardika I Made Mika Parwita Imam Kuswardayan Indra Kharisma Raharjana Irfandianto, Taqarra Rayhan Irsyad Arif Mashudi Istighfar, Muhammad Bagus Ivan Agung Pandapotan izqi Paradisiaca , Brian R Karimi, Muhammad Ihsan Karolita, Devi Kristina , Kristina Kusuma, Selvia Ferdiana Luh Putu Ary Sri Tjahyanti Mauladani, Furqon Mirotus Solekhah Mohammad Nazir Arifin Muhamad, Fachrul Pralienka Bani Muhammad Dery Rahma Muhammad Ihsan Karimi Mutia Rahmi Dewi Nafi', Abdun Nafingatun Ngaliah Nanang Fakhrur Rozi Nugroho, Tri Yulianto Nuralamsyah, Bintang Nurul Fajrin Ariyani Nurul Jannah Pasaribu, Monalisa Patricia Gertrudis Manek Peter Gelu Pratama Wirya Atmaja Putra Kurniawan, Arya Putri, Rahmi Rizkiana Rahmi Rizkiana Putri Rakhmat Arianto Ramadhani, Nia Rasi Aziizah Andrahsmara Reza Fauzan Reza Fauzan Richard Alvin Sianturi Riduwan, Muhammad Risnauli Sumiati Sinaga Riyanarto Sarno Rizky Januar Akbar Royke Wenas Rully Soelaiman Rully Soelaiman Safitri, Winda Ayu Samosir, Hernawati Sari Sahadi, Fitria Vera Sarwosri Sarwosri Sarwosri Sarwosri Sarwosri Satrio Agung Wicaksono Shiddiqi, Ary Mazharuddin Siahaan, Gabriel Silaban, Monica Sinaga, Hasan Siti Rochimah Sitohang, Francisko Situmorang, Andreas Supriyanto, Ricky Tiurma Lumban Gaol Tony Dwi Susanto Toshihiro Kita Umam, Busro Umami, Izzatul Umi Yuhana Utomo Pujianto Vriza Wahyu Saputra Welly Purnomo Yuhana, Umi Laili Yuhana, Umi Laili Yunata Dede Pratiwi